2009 : Books I Read This Year

I am a seasonal reader; which means some seasons I read a ton and in others not so much. But here's a blurb about books I've read this year. We should always be learning and listening to other voices. I recommend reading many different authors :). And if folks tell you not to read a certain author,  I'd go ahead and read them and let the holy spirit guide you. The * are ones I really enjoyed.

*Hudson Taylor's Spiritual Secret (Hudson's Family):  A classic on going-all-in, exegeting your culture and missional living.

Missional Church (Guder): States the theory that inviting folks to join our christian community first will lead to life transformation second.

*Heart of a Servant Leader (Jack Miller): Pastoral letters to missionaries around the world. It drips of gospel sonship.

*Vintage Jesus (Driscoll): Sarcastic and revealing look at who Jesus really was--and is.

Vintage Church (Driscoll): Sarcastic and revealing look at what the church should be.

*The Yankee Years (Joe Torre): Guide to dealing with stress and finding your leadership style.

*Reaching the Campus Tribes (Hines): Why we need to blow-up most college ministry methodology and start over for each of our unique campuses.

**The Unlikely Disciple (Roose): A non-christian college student transfers from Brown to Liberty for a semester and lives to tell the tale.

Idols of the Heart (Fitzpatrick): What happens when you don't believe the gospel.

Serving As a Church Greeter (Parrott): Loving people well the moment they walk through the door of your church..

*I Once Was Lost (Everts): A fascinating look at the '5 thresholds' folks must walk through as they come to faith--it's my story too.

Compelled by Love (Stetzer): What should motivate you to live missionally.

*Practicing Greatness (McNeal): How to lead well.

Off Road Disciplines (Creps): The title got me.. I'll admit.. but it is full of reminders of the disciplines that will keep you walking with Him.

Re:Jesus (Frost): How we should be mini-Jesus's to the world.

The Blueprint (Ma): Helping college students to see themselves as missionaries on the campus.

Sticky Church (Osborne): How to get folks to stick to your church--the right folks.

On the NT, OT, Church Leadership, God (Driscoll): Attempt at being brief and sarcastic while sharing deep truths

**Ordering Your Private World (Macdonald): I read it every year.

*The Shack (Young): I should have read it years ago--don't think too deeply--just enjoy the story. It's fiction remember? :)

*Going Rogue (Sarah Palin Bio): She got screwed by the man.. beware she knows how to handle a gun.. and wild caribou

Irresistible Revolution (Claiborne): Christian Pacifist calls for a new way of living.. in Philly

What should I read next year??? :) Holy spirit on 3!
